#420f52 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#420f52 is composed of 25.9% red, 5.9% green and 32.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 19.5% cyan, 81.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 67.8% black. It has a hue angle of 285.7 degrees, a saturation of 69.1% and a lightness of 19%. #420f52 color hex could be obtained by blending #841ea4 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330066.

● #420f52 color description : Very dark magenta.
#420f52 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#420f52 has RGB values of R:66, G:15, B:82 and CMYK values of C:0.2, M:0.82, Y:0, K:0.68. Its decimal value is 4329298.

Shades and Tints of #420f52
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0310 is the darkest color, while #fffeff is the lightest one.
